The Certificate Programme in Intersectional Design Thinking for Education is a comprehensive course that empowers learners with the essential skills needed to excel in the rapidly evolving education industry. This programme integrates intersectional design thinking, a unique approach that considers the interconnectedness of diverse experiences and perspectives, to create inclusive and equitable learning environments.

The UK education sector is experiencing a significant shift with the integration of intersectional design thinking methodologies. As a result, several in-demand roles are emerging, including: 1. **Instructional Designer**: These professionals are responsible for creating engaging and effective learning experiences. With the growing emphasis on inclusive design, instructional designers must now consider multiple perspectives and needs, ensuring that educational materials are accessible and relevant to diverse user groups. 2. **UX/UI Designer**: User experience and user interface designers focus on creating intuitive, visually appealing interfaces that cater to various learning styles and preferences. As intersectional design thinking gains traction, these roles require professionals to consider how different users interact with educational platforms and resources. 3. **Learning Experience Designer**: A learning experience designer combines instructional design and UX/UI expertise to create seamless, engaging, and inclusive learning experiences. This role demands versatility, as professionals must balance the needs of educators, learners, and administrators. 4. **Educational Technologist**: Professionals in this field apply technology to support and enhance educational processes. With an intersectional design thinking approach, educational technologists must ensure that chosen technologies cater to a diverse user base and do not perpetuate existing biases or exclusionary practices. 5. **Data Visualization Designer**: Data visualization designers create meaningful, visually appealing representations of complex data. As intersectional design thinking becomes increasingly important, data visualization designers must consider how their work can be adapted to cater to diverse learning needs and preferences.
